Omnia is an innovative AI visibility tool designed for brands and marketers aiming to understand how artificial intelligence perceives and interacts with their online presence. By revealing the AI prompts influencing search results and content recommendations, Omnia empowers users to optimize their branding strategies effectively. Its core features include monitoring brand presence across various platforms, benchmarking against competitors, and generating content tailored to boost visibility and citations in AI-powered search environments. This makes it an invaluable resource for businesses seeking to stay ahead in AI-driven marketing landscapes. Omnia stands out by providing actionable insights into AI perceptions, enabling brands to adapt their messaging, improve search rankings, and enhance overall brand authority with concrete, data-backed strategies.

OpenClaw is an innovative AI-powered personal agent that transforms your computer into a 24/7 automation hub, accessible from popular chat platforms like WhatsApp and Telegram. Building on its predecessors Moltbot and Clawbot, OpenClaw offers extensive control over your system, enabling users to execute shell commands, manage files, control browsers, and automate workflows seamlessly. Its persistent memory and full system access make it a powerful tool for developers, tech enthusiasts, and productivity-focused individuals seeking a highly customizable automation experience. What sets OpenClaw apart is its open-source foundation, over 50 integrations, and emphasis on privacy by operating locally on your machine, ensuring sensitive data remains secure. Its versatility and ease of access make it an attractive solution for those looking to enhance productivity, streamline repetitive tasks, or build complex automation pipelines using familiar chat interfaces.
